About

Philip Wong is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Hepatology and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Philip Wong has authored 123 papers receiving a total of 3.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 57 papers in Epidemiology, 52 papers in Hepatology and 28 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Philip Wong’s work include Liver Disease Diagnosis and Treatment (42 papers), Hepatitis C virus research (28 papers) and Liver Disease and Transplantation (27 papers). Philip Wong is often cited by papers focused on Liver Disease Diagnosis and Treatment (42 papers), Hepatitis C virus research (28 papers) and Liver Disease and Transplantation (27 papers). Philip Wong collaborates with scholars based in Canada, United States and United Kingdom. Philip Wong's co-authors include Kevin D. Mullen, Hendrik Vilstrup, Juan Córdoba, Piero Amodio, Jasmohan S. Bajaj, Karin Weißenborn, Péter Ferenci, Marc Deschênes, Peter Ghali and K.S. Shah and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Gastroenterology and PLoS ONE.
